ORIENTATION AND REACTIVITY IN FREE RADICAL AROMATIC SUBSTITUTION.

Abstract

A summary is given of work involving the study of orientation and reactivity in free radical aromatic substitution, with particular emphasis on polar factors. The principle approach was to study the attack by substituted phenyl radicals (chiefly from peroxide decomposition) on aromatic compounds. In addition, investigations were undertaken to (1) redetermine orientation and reactivity in simple phenylation; (2) test the validity of previously determined rate factors for the reaction Ar- + Ar'H yields ArAr'H-; and (3) study ester formation in peroxide ((ArCOO)2) decompositions.
